		<description><![CDATA[Style blog Mainely Mara has published a guide to spicy hot cocktails at Grace, Zapoteca, Sonny&#8217;s and El Rayo Cantina. The February issue of Down East includes a feature story on the Maine hot sauce industry. Taco Escobarr has launched a pair of hot sauces which are on sale at the restaurant.]]></description>
